Key Street Insights
Gay Gardens is a residential street with 118 addresses.
It ranks as the 199th largest and 224th most expensive of the 241 streets in the RM10 area. The most common property type is a early-century house built between 1912 and 1935.
The street contains a total of 118 properties: 118 houses.

Sales Market Trendson Gay Gardens
The last sale on Gay Gardens sold for £480,000 on 6th February 2025. Since then prices are down an average of 2.0%.
The current average value in the street is £443,299.
The Gay Gardens Sales Market has increased by 28.7% over the last 10 years.

Sales Historyon Gay Gardens, Dagenham, RM10
The last sale was on 6th February 2025 for £480,000 and since then the market in the area has decreased by 2.0%. The street has had a total of 117 sales since 1995.
Gay Gardens, Dagenham, RM10 has seen 8 sales in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.
